About this strategy

CORE PRINCIPLE
The strategy is based on the core idea that capital flows from an asset class to another, and such shifts in capital allocation occur according to the perceived economic conditions. The strategy employs proprietary quantitative tools to detect such shifts in probabilistic terms and creating a portfolio weight scheme that maximize the probability of being allocated in the strong assets in which capital is flowing. This compounds with a rigorous systematic risk management procedure that aims to deliver stable return over time, with little or no correlation to the market.

INVESTMENT PROCEDURE
Phase 1 - Information Processing
After having processed all relevant market informations, the model estimates the probabilities for each asset class to be the most performing.
Phase 2 - Weighting Scheme
A rigorous risk management procedure outputs the weights that maximize the chance of stable growth, given the probabilities estimated in Phase 1.
Phase 3 - Exposure
A self-learning system elaborates the relevant informations to estimate the current market conditions and the probabilities of tail events to unfold in the future. Such probabilities are then assembled into a market risk score, according to which portfolio exposure may be set in a range 0%-200% to improve the performances in
risk-off periods and reduce losses in risk-on phases.

PORTFOLIO MANAGEMENT
Traded Instruments
The model trades asset class ETFs, which include Domestic/International-Developed/Emerging Equities, Government/Corporate-ShortTerm/LongTerm-AAA/BB Bonds, Energy/Agriculture/Raw Materials Commodities, Gold and precious metals, Currencies. To gain exposure grater than 100% levered ETFs may be traded.
Trade Frequency
The average holding period is 1 month, the model trades about 4/5 ETFs per month. During period of extreme volatility holding frequency may shorten, resulting in a faster adapting allocation.
